Six fresh dough balls, twisted rather than rolled, then finished with Biscoff biscuit crumb and melted white chocolate. The twist is structural: it opens up more surface for the topping to catch in, so the chocolate and crumb sit through the piece instead of just on top of it. Biscoff is doing a lot of work here. The caramelised biscuit flavour is sharper than the white chocolate around it, and the two together lean noticeably sweeter than the garlic and herb dough balls that have been on the menu for years. It sits in the dessert section rather than the sides, which is a change of role for a format Domino's has mostly used as a starter. Added to the UK menu in September 2026, alongside the Honey Chilli Chicken pizza and a new ranch dip.
